Alcohol Test Services

Alcohol testing involves the assessment of blood alcohol concentration to determine recent alcohol consumption. It's critical in many professional and legal settings, particularly for safety-sensitive roles. Tests are conducted using breath, blood, or saliva samples with results impacting employment and legal decisions.

Learn More

Alcohol Testing is used in many settings

  • Workplace safety programs
  • DOT compliance
  • Legal and probation settings
  • Post-accident investigations
  • Rehabilitation assessments
  • Personal monitoring

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• Sweat patch

Breathalyzer - Used for quick, on-the-spot testing, especially in law enforcement.
Blood test - Provides precise measurements, often used in medical settings.
Saliva test - Offers a non-invasive option with moderate detection windows.
Urine test - More common in workplace testing due to cost-effectiveness.
Sweat patch - Used for continuous monitoring over a set period.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in McQueen, Oklahoma is a reliable forensic method that allows for the detection of drug history over an extended period. This approach analyzes keratin in the nail, retaining a chronological record of drug usage. It is highly effective and favored in circumstances requiring a detailed history.
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Offers a 6-month or longer detection period.
  • Toenails: Provides an extended detection window of up to 8 months.

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Marijuana
  • Cocaine
  • Opiates
  • Amphetamines
  • Methamphetamines

Advantages over other methods

  • Long detection period
  • Non-invasive and easy collection
  • Highly accurate results
  • Minimal risk of contamination
  • Hard to adulterate specimens

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for Duty Exams: Determines employee’s capability
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Verifies mask effectiveness
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Checks lung capacity
  • Tuberculosis (TB) Screening: Detects infection
  • Vision Testing: Assures perfect sight
  • Audiometric Testing: Monitors hearing capacity

If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
